Job Description
• Teach assigned classes, groups or individuals
• Maintain classroom discipline and promote positive behaviour
• Ensure pupil Health and Safety
• To assist with the development and implementation of effective identification and assessment procedures for pupils with additional support needs
• Develop or contribute to the development of teaching and assessment materials with particular reference to pupils with additional support needs
• Use the results of assessment to evaluate and improve teaching, and the learning and attainment of pupils
• Set and maintain targets for pupils as appropriate
• Contribute to the preparation of pupils for internal and external assessments as appropriate
• Assist with the administration of internal and external assessments as appropriate
• Meet with parents/carers to review pupil progress and ongoing additional support needs
• Contribute to the effective running of stage/curricular area/subject or department
• Contribute to Improvement Planning, evaluation and quality assurance processes
• Plan, prepare and record appropriate work for pupils both individually and in partnership with class teachers
• Advise and guide pupils on issues related to their education
• Report and discuss pupils’ progress with their parents and any other bodies which have statutory functions relating to the care of children
• Assist in the delivery of appropriate therapeutic activities for pupils
• Identify and evaluate resources appropriate to meet the additional support needs of individual pupils
• Consult and advise on the development of individualised educational programmes and any legislative obligations in respect of additional support needsThe Individual

This post is considered to be a ‘Regulated Role’ under the Disclosure (Scotland) Act 2020. Under the Act it is a legal requirement for an individual undertaking a regulated role with children or protected adults to be a member of the Protecting Vulnerable Groups (PVG) scheme. Therefore the successful candidate will be required to join the PVG Scheme or undergo a PVG Scheme Update check prior to any formal offer of employment being made by Moray Council.
